npm源查看如何查看源支持的商业协议?
随着我国互联网技术的飞速发展,越来越多的企业和开发者开始使用npm源进行包的安装和管理。然而,对于一些商业用户来说,了解npm源支持的商业协议显得尤为重要。本文将详细介绍如何查看npm源支持的商业协议,帮助您更好地了解和使用npm源。
一、npm源简介
npm(Node Package Manager)是Node.js的包管理器,也是全球最大的JavaScript包注册库。通过npm,开发者可以轻松地查找、安装、管理和共享JavaScript包。npm源是npm包的存储地,提供了丰富的包资源。
二、查看npm源支持的商业协议
- 访问npm官网
首先,您需要访问npm官网(https://www.npmjs.com/)。在官网上,您可以找到关于npm源支持的商业协议的详细信息。
- 查看npm源支持的商业协议
在npm官网首页,您可以看到“Terms of Use”和“Privacy Policy”两个链接。点击“Terms of Use”即可查看npm源支持的商业协议。
三、npm源支持的商业协议内容
- 许可协议
npm源支持的商业协议中,许可协议是核心内容。它规定了用户在使用npm源时,必须遵守的许可协议。常见的许可协议包括:
- MIT协议:允许用户自由使用、修改和分发代码,只需保留原始协议的声明。
- Apache 2.0协议:允许用户自由使用、修改和分发代码,只需保留原始协议的声明。
- GPL协议:要求用户在使用、修改和分发代码时,必须遵守原始协议的声明。
- 隐私政策
npm源支持的商业协议中还包含了隐私政策。它规定了npm如何收集、使用和保护用户数据。用户在使用npm源时,应仔细阅读隐私政策,了解自己的数据权益。
- 版权声明
npm源支持的商业协议中还包含了版权声明。它说明了npm源中的包的版权归属,以及用户在使用这些包时,应遵守的相关规定。
四、案例分析
以某企业为例,该企业计划使用npm源进行项目开发。在了解npm源支持的商业协议后,企业发现以下问题:
- 项目中使用了多个开源包,需要确认这些包的许可协议是否满足企业需求。
- 企业需要了解npm如何收集和使用用户数据,以确保数据安全。
针对这些问题,企业应:
- 查阅每个开源包的许可协议,确认其是否符合企业需求。
- 仔细阅读npm的隐私政策,了解数据收集和使用情况。
五、总结
了解npm源支持的商业协议对于商业用户来说至关重要。通过查看npm源支持的商业协议,用户可以确保在使用npm源时,遵守相关法律法规,保护自身权益。本文详细介绍了如何查看npm源支持的商业协议,希望对您有所帮助。
猜你喜欢:业务性能指标